About the role
We are seeking an experienced Project Manager to lead the delivery of a significant organisation wide business transformation initiative. Working closely with senior leaders and key stakeholders, you will coordinate multiple workstreams, manage project timelines, and drive successful project outcomes across the organisation. Reporting to the Director of Human Resources, this role is responsible for the planning, coordination, governance, and successful delivery of a complex project that impacts multiple functions and stakeholder groups. The successful candidate will ensure project activities remain aligned to agreed objectives, timelines, and deliverables while fostering effective collaboration across the organisation.
This is an 18 Month Maximum Term (Part time 0.6 EFT with flexibility to scale to Full Time) opportunity based in South Melbourne within the Support Services unit. This position reports to the Director of Human Resources.

Key Selection Criteria:
To be successful in this role, you will have:
- Proven experience delivering complex business transformation, or organisational change projects from planning through to successful completion.
- Strong project planning, coordination, and organisational sk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ities and meet project deadlines.
- Demonstrated ability to establish and maintain effective project governance.
- Excellent stakeholder engagement, communication, and relationship management skills, with the ability to influence and collaborate across diverse teams and organisational levels.
- Proven experience monitoring project performance, tracking deliverables, and ensuring accountability for outcomes and agreed actions.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, including the ability to identify risks, assess impacts, and implement effective mitigation strategies.
- Highly developed reporting and documentation skills, with the ability to prepare high quality project plans, status reports, governance papers, and progress updates.
- Exceptional time management skills, attention to detail, and the ability to maintain accurate records in a fast paced environment.
- Relevant project management qualifications will be highly regarded.
